    Came for the outdoor pool with my husband and two kids. Since it is summer, it was pretty busy even…read moreon a weekday and spots fill up fast. Unlike the Hollywood location, there is a large shaded area with lots of seats available. The pool was clean and a good temperature. There is a slide for smaller kids and two big slides for older kids and adults. They offer life jackets for free. You can bring your own food and drinks. Entry was cheap and cash only, paid right up at the gates where the pool is. Overall we love the outdoor pool here and plan to come more often this summer.
